Form authorizations

In PANTHEON, there are over one thousand and seven hundred authorisations for which we can set permissions. For each authorisation, it is defined with which form it is connected. This information enables us to check permissions for authorisations on individual forms as well.

The feature, with which we check and edit authorisations on the form where we are currently at and for the user, can be accessed on arbitrary PANTHEON forms,, by clicking the Templates button in the toolbar, and then selecting Form authorisations.

CASE SUMMARY

Due to unexpected longer absence of an employee, accounting needed additional help with entering data on receiving documents. For this purpose, they trained an employee from the purchase department, Purchase Pat, to take over part of tasks for data input. When Pat started working on document 1700, the program reported that she does not have permissions.

Pat checked her authorisations on the form and let the person responsible at the company know that the proper permissions on authorisations must be set for her, so that she can do her work without interruption. Purchase Pat does this in the following way:

 

On document 1700, she wants to check the permissions on authorisations for data input, which are connected to the aforementioned form.

For this purpose, she clicks the Templates button and selects Form authorisations.

The Form authorisations form opens, where Purchase Pat can see the tree structure the authorisations that are connected to the form.

Next to each authorisation, she sees an icon, from which she can see what type of permission is set.

In this case, Purchase Pat realizes that she has no permissions (or has the permission none) on authorisations.

To be able to do her work properly, she needs to have at least the Read permission on all authorisations.

She lets the person responsible know what she has realized, so that the person responsible can set her the proper permissions for authorisations.
